CHPTR is a unique boutique collection of 21 one, two, and three bedroom apartments tucked away at the east side of London Fields. The development is gated, and the light and spacious high-spec apartments are grouped around a landscaped central courtyard. All have private terraces or balconies.
The apartments are built to a high specification, with underfloor heating, engineered wood flooring, and concrete feature wall sections. The fixtures are high quality, with black/brushed bronze ironmongery throughout and Bosch integrated appliances and stone worktops & splashbacks in the kitchens.
This increasingly sought-after neighborhood offers the best of city living in the creative heart of Hackney. Artists, brewers, makers, and bakers sit alongside pioneering new workspaces and developments. An intoxicating mix of the old and new reflects the area’s industrial heritage, with converted warehouses, loft-style new build apartments, and a wide range of artisan shops, bars, and restaurants in and around the nearby railway arches.
Everything you need is on your doorstep, from a wide range of local shops to nearby green space and excellent transport connections. Popular Broadway Market is a short walk away, offering everything from a local fishmonger, butcher, and baker to eclectic vintage, books, and clothing stores in addition to numerous coffee shops, bars, and restaurants.
Hackney has the most green space of any inner London borough and is the cycling capital of the UK. At CHPTR you are surrounded by opportunities for a walk or ride in the park, from London Fields (a mere 2 minutes walk) and the Regents’ canal towpath to Haggerston Park, Victoria Park, and the extensive Olympic Park. The area is surrounded by a cycle route network and crisscrossed by dedicated cycle routes. Public transport links are excellent, with easy access to three Overground lines via nearby London Fields, Hackney Central, Dalston Junction or Haggerston, and Bethnal Green Underground station just a mile away.
